72-Year-Old Woman Punched Outside Russ & Daughters, Cops Say
An older woman was attacked by a finger-wagging stranger outside the Houston Street deli, video shows.

EAST VILLAGE, NY — A 72-year-old woman was punched to the concrete outside Russ & Daughters last week and police are still looking for the person who did it.
Video shows the elderly woman was attacked on East Houston and Allen streets just before 6 p.m. Nov. 12., police said.
A person in puffy jacket and hood shoves the woman to the ground then walks away waving a finger at the 72-year-old, the video shows.

The woman refused medical treatment, according to police.
Police released the video over the weekend and asked anyone with information about the encounter to contact the NYPD.
